  • Importing HDV Quicktime Into Avid Xpress Pro-Mac

    Posted by Brad Sch. on March 28, 2006 at 6:55 pm

    I’ve got a workflow down here with one hiccup, picture moray and slight color shifting on the image. If I can solve this, it’ll be a great workflo wfor me and others to copy.

    1. Digitize full rez HDV files from Canon XLH1 into Final Cut Pro. I shot HDV 24F.
    2.Import Quicktime files into Avid.
    3.Edit
    4.Reimport project after offline cut in Nitris, taking advantage of it’s HD capabilities.
    5.Output finished product onto HDCAM.
    6.Celebrate finished project.

    -My only problem is when I import the HDV 1920x1080i files into Avid, I get the above color shifting. Any idea on what import settings should be, or why this is happening?
